这个作为生产者的PyObject*的type必须填写tp_as_buffer插槽。这个插槽是一个PyBufferProcs对象,它包含两个函数指针类型的成员,一个是bf_getbuffer函数指针,其签名为int (PyObject *exporter, Py_buffer *view, int flags),另一个是bf_releasebuffer函数指针,其签名为void (PyObject *exporter, Py_buffer *view)。
AttributeError: 'int' object has no attribute 'abc' BufferError 当与缓冲区相关的操作无法执行时将被引发。 没用过,有时间再说。 EOFError 当input()函数未读取任何数据即达到文件结束条件 (EOF) 时将被引发。Linux上为Ctrl+d,Windows上为Ctrl+Z+Enter。 s = input('please input something:') 1. 博主...
异常的名字都以Error结尾,我们在为自定义异常命名的时候也需要遵守这一规范,就跟标准的异常命名一样。 以下为与RuntimeError相关的实例,实例中创建了一个类,基类为RuntimeError,用于在异常触发时输出更多的信息。 异常类中可以定义任何其它类中可以定义的东西,但是通常为了保持简单,只在其中加入几个属性信息,以供异常...
IOError 输入/输出操作失败 OSError 操作系统错误 WindowsError 系统调用失败 ImportError 导入模块/对象失败 LookupError 无效数据查询的基类 IndexError 序列中没有此索引(index) KeyError 映射中没有这个键 MemoryError 内存溢出错误(对于Python 解释器不是致命的) NameError 未声明/初始化对象 (没有属性) UnboundLocalE...
the error i get: Traceback (most recent call last): File "assembler.py", line 11, in <module> input = open(file, 'r') TypeError: coercing to Unicode: need string or buffer, type found how i run the program: python assembler.py Add.asm where Add.asm id the file i want to...
其中BaseException,Exception,ArithmeticError,BufferError,LookupError主要被作为其他异常的基类。 语法错误 在Python中,对于异常和错误通常可以分为两类,第一类是语法错误,又称解析错误。也就是代码还没有开始运行,就发生的错误。 其产生的原因就是编写的代码不符合Python的语言规范: ...
inencryp t ciphertext = self._cipher.encrypt(plaintext, output=output) File"C:\Users\EQUIPO\AppData\Local\Programs\Python\Python37-32\lib\site-packages\Crypto\Cipher\_mode_ctr.py", line189,inencryp t ciphertext = create_string_buffer(len(plaintext)) TypeError:objectoftype'_io.TextIOWrapper...
+-- FloatingPointError +-- OverflowError +-- ZeroDivisionError +-- AttributeError +-- SyntaxError +-- IndentationError +-- TabError +-- SystemError +-- CodecRegistryError +-- ImportError +-- ZipImportError +-- BufferError +-- LookupError ...
1. TypeError: coercing to Unicode: need string or buffer, type found Traceback (most recent calllast): File"unzip.py", line20,in<module>tar= tarfile.open(file) File"/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/tarfile.py", line1658,inopen ...
最近在调研Netty的使用,在编写编码解码模块的时候遇到了一个中文字符串编码和解码异常的情况,后来发现是...